Switching from Private to Public health Insurance in Germany

WEBCase 1: If you are an employee, the only way back to the public health insurance system is when your yearly income falls below the limit of less than EUR 60.750 (in 2019). To achieve this, you can ask your employer to reduce your hours or move some of your earnings into a pension scheme. Case 2: If you are over 55 it is almost impossible.

Private health insurance in Germany – Complete Guide

WEBIf you are an employee and earn less than 60.750€ per year (in 2019), you can’t be privately insured. You must have public health insurance. You can’t choose private health insurance. If you are a student, a doctor or a civil servant, you can choose private health insurance. Read Also: Comparison of Health Insurance Options in Germany.

How to get German Citizenship or a Permanent Residence

WEBCost of becoming a German citizen. German permanent residence costs around EUR 260. To become a German citizen via naturalisation costs EUR 255 (or EUR 51 for accompanying children), although low-income earners and large families might be offered to pay less or in instalments.
